#573460

The hexadecimal color code #573460 corresponds to the code RGB( 87, 52, 96 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,34 level), green (at 0,20 level) and blue (at 0,38 level). Its brightness is 29% and its saturation is 29%. It is composed of red at 37%, green at 22% and blue at 40%.

The complementary color #A8CB9F is the color exactly opposite to #573460 on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#573460 in CSS

When using #573460 as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#573460 as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
